Method of and system for associating an electronic signature with an electronic record
First Claim
1. A method of associating an electronic signature with an electronic record in a computer system, the method comprising:
- allowing a user to define an event that, upon occurrence, generates an electronic record that requires an electronic signature;
allowing a user to define the fields stored in the electronic record;
allowing a user to generate a map that maps data from underlying database tables to at least some of the fields defined for the electronic record;
allowing a user to define a layout for displaying data in the electronic record on a computer display when an electronic signature for the data record is collected;
allowing a user to identify a signatory approver for the electronic record;
in response to the occurrence of the event, generating the electronic record and displaying the electronic record to the signatory approver according to the defined layout;
receiving an electronic signature from the signatory approver; and
associating the electronic signature with the electronic record.
1 Assignment
0 Petitions
Accused Products
Abstract
A method of and system for associating an electronic signature with an electronic record in a computer system. In one embodiment the method comprises allowing a user to define an event that, upon occurrence, generates an electronic record that requires an electronic signature; allowing a user to define the fields stored in the electronic record; allowing a user to generate a map that maps data from underlying database tables to at least some of the fields defined for the electronic record; allowing a user to define a layout for displaying data in the electronic record on a computer display when an electronic signature for the data record is collected; allowing a user to identify a signatory approver for the electronic record; generating the electronic record and displaying the electronic record to the signatory approver according to the defined layout in response to the occurrence of the event; receiving an electronic signature from the signatory approver; and associating the electronic signature with the electronic record. Some embodiments further comprise verifying the electronic signature prior to associating the signature with the electronic record.
100 Citations
22 Claims
-
1. A method of associating an electronic signature with an electronic record in a computer system, the method comprising:
-
allowing a user to define an event that, upon occurrence, generates an electronic record that requires an electronic signature;
allowing a user to define the fields stored in the electronic record;
allowing a user to generate a map that maps data from underlying database tables to at least some of the fields defined for the electronic record;
allowing a user to define a layout for displaying data in the electronic record on a computer display when an electronic signature for the data record is collected;
allowing a user to identify a signatory approver for the electronic record;
in response to the occurrence of the event, generating the electronic record and displaying the electronic record to the signatory approver according to the defined layout;
receiving an electronic signature from the signatory approver; and
associating the electronic signature with the electronic record.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A computer system that manages electronic records stored in a database, the computer system comprising:
-
a processor;
a database; and
a computer-readable memory coupled to the processor, the computer-readable memory configured to store a computer program;
wherein the processor is operative with the computer program to;
(i) allow a user to define an event that, upon occurrence, generates an electronic record that requires an electronic signature;
(ii) allow a user to define the fields stored in the electronic record;
(iii) allow a user to generate a map that maps data from underlying database tables to at least some of the fields defined for the electronic record;
(iv) allow a user to define a layout for displaying data in the electronic record on a computer display when an electronic signature for the data record is collected;
(v) allow a user to identify a signatory approver for the electronic record;
(vi) generate the electronic record and displaying the electronic record to the signatory approver according to the defined layout in response to the occurrence of the event;
(vii) receive an electronic signature from the signatory approver; and
(viii) associate the electronic signature with the electronic record.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. A computer program stored on a computer-readable storage medium for managing electronic records stored in a database, the computer program comprising:
-
code for allowing a user to define an event that, upon occurrence, generates an electronic record that requires an electronic signature;
code for allowing a user to define the fields stored in the electronic record;
code for allowing a user to generate a map that maps data from underlying database tables to at least some of the fields defined for the electronic record;
code for allowing a user to define a layout for displaying data in the electronic record on a computer display when an electronic signature for the data record is collected;
code for allowing a user to identify a signatory approver for the electronic record;
code for, in response to the occurrence of the event, generating the electronic record and displaying the electronic record to the signatory approver according to the defined layout;
code for receiving an electronic signature from the signatory approver; and
code for associating the electronic signature with the electronic record. - View Dependent Claims (18, 19, 20, 21, 22)
-
Specification